Real-Life Use: Customizing a Thankful Teacher Tote Bag
Let’s imagine a real-life scenario where I use the Thankful Teacher Thanksgiving SVG Design to create a custom embroidered tote bag. The design would sit nicely on the front of the bag, centered and prominent. I’d start by considering the fabric type—probably a cotton canvas or similar material that can handle embroidery without stretching or puckering.
I’d also think about the hoop size needed. Since the design isn’t too large, it should fit comfortably within a standard 5x7 inch hoop. However, if I wanted to add more elements or expand the design slightly, I might need a larger hoop. It’s always wise to test the design on scrap fabric before committing to a final product.
One thing I’d check is the stitch density. With the option to change colors easily, I could experiment with different thread shades to match the tote bag’s color scheme. If the background is dark, I’d ensure there’s enough contrast so the text remains visible. A light-colored thread on a dark fabric would work best for readability and visual impact.
For a tote bag, I’d also consider using a stabilizer underneath to prevent any distortion during stitching. This ensures the finished product looks neat and professional, which is crucial for selling handmade items or offering them as gift options.

Practical Embroidery Designer Notes
If you're planning to use the Thankful Teacher Thanksgiving SVG Design, here are some practical tips to keep in mind:
- Test on scrap fabric before finalizing your project to ensure the design looks good and stitches cleanly.
- Check thread color contrast against your chosen fabric to make sure the text is readable and visually appealing.
- Review stitch density and adjust if necessary to avoid overcrowding or under-stitching.
- Confirm hoop size and prepare your machine accordingly.
- Inspect small details to ensure they translate well when stitched.
- Test in black and white mockups to see how the design will look on different fabric backgrounds.
- Use proper stabilizer to maintain the integrity of the fabric and the design.
- Check licensing before selling finished items or digital products to ensure compliance.
